- The distance between Campobasso, Italy and Tampa, Florida, Usa is approximately 8,539 km or 5,306 mi.
- To reach Campobasso in this distance one would set out from Tampa, Florida bearing 49.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Campobasso bearing 115.8° or ESE .
- Campobasso has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Tampa, Florida has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The annual average temperature is 10.4 °C (18.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.2 °C (9.4°F) more in Campobasso.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 488 mm (19.2 in) less which is equivalent to 488 l/m² (11.98 US gal/ft²) or 4,880,000 l/ha (521,704 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.6° lower in Campobasso than in Tampa, Florida.
- Relative humidity levels are 11.5%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 7.2°C (13°F) lower.
